将证书导入不到jdk的cacerts
时间: 2024-05-15 17:13:48 浏览: 189
nexus的jdk证书cacerts
如果你想要将证书导入到 JDK 的 cacerts 文件中,可以按照以下步骤进行操作:
1. 打开命令提示符或终端窗口。
2. 切换到 JDK 的 bin 目录,例如:`cd /path/to/jdk/bin`。
3. 运行以下命令,将证书导入到 cacerts 文件中:
```
keytool -import -alias mycert -file /path/to/mycert.crt -keystore ../jre/lib/security/cacerts
```
其中,`mycert` 是你为证书指定的别名,`/path/to/mycert.crt` 是证书文件的路径,`../jre/lib/security/cacerts` 是 cacerts 文件的路径。
4. 根据提示输入 cacerts 文件的密码,默认的密码是 `changeit`。
5. 如果导入成功,你会看到以下提示信息:
```
Trust this certificate? [no]: yes
Certificate was added to keystore
```
6. 现在,你可以使用 JDK 中的 SSL/TLS 客户端来访问使用该证书保护的 HTTPS 网站或其他服务了。
注意:如果你没有权限修改 JDK 安装目录下的文件,你可以将 cacerts 文件复制到其他目录,导入证书后再将其拷贝回原来的位置。
阅读全文